1. A method for acquiring a time adjustment at a user equipment (UE), comprising:

  • entering a sleep mode;

    waking from the sleep mode after a predetermined period of time passes;

    signaling uplink information at the UE, the uplink information providing an uplink timing of the UE;

    determining whether a timing adjustment command has issued, wherein the issuance of the timing adjustment command is based on properties of the UE;

    adjusting the uplink timing at the UE based on the issued timing adjustment command when a timing adjustment command is determined to have issued; and

    reentering the sleep mode without the adjusting when no timing adjustment command is determined to have issued;

    wherein the properties of the UE comprise at least one of a velocity of the UE and a current synchronization timing of the UE.
